在Java Web开发中,JSP(JavaServer Pages)是一种常用的技术,它允许我们动态生成HTML页面。而数据库则是存储和管理数据的仓库。将JSP与数据库结合起来,可以实现数据的动态查询、插入、更新和删除等功能。本文将带您从零开始,学习如何使用JSP调用数据库进行查询操作。
1. 准备工作
在开始之前,我们需要准备以下环境:

1. Java开发环境:JDK(Java Development Kit)
2. Web服务器:如Tomcat
3. 数据库:如MySQL
4. 数据库驱动:根据数据库类型下载对应的JDBC驱动
2. 创建数据库和表
我们需要在数据库中创建一个表,用于存储示例数据。以下以MySQL为例:
```sql
CREATE DATABASE jspdemo;
USE jspdemo;
CREATE TABLE students (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
age INT,
gender ENUM('男', '女')
);
```
然后,插入一些示例数据:
```sql
INSERT INTO students (name, age, gender) VALUES ('张三', 20, '男');
INSERT INTO students (name, age, gender) VALUES ('李四', 21, '女');
INSERT INTO students (name, age, gender) VALUES ('王五', 22, '男');
```
3. 配置数据库驱动
将下载的数据库驱动jar包放置到Web服务器的lib目录下,如Tomcat的lib目录。然后,在JSP页面中,我们需要通过以下代码加载驱动:
```java
<%@ page import="







